Good morning! It’s 28th December, and here’s your Chile daily news capsule.

A PDI officer fatally shoots an assailant during a vehicle theft attempt in Maipú.

Meteorology issues a warning for extreme heat, with temperatures reaching up to 37 degrees.

Codelco and SQM announce a joint venture to exploit lithium in the Salar de Atacama.

Multiple regions in Chile are under red alert due to extreme heat and fire risks.

The government invites opposition leaders to ease tensions over wage adjustments and regulations.

A fire damages two commercial galleries in Estación Central, reportedly starting in a construction area.

Calls for the dismissal of the Chilean ambassador in New Zealand arise after a controversial post.

A 20-year-old man drowns while swimming with friends at a beach in Futrono.

A forest fire in Pichidegua was ignited by children playing with a lighter during Christmas.

A Chilean student is named ALMA Ambassador for 2026, marking a significant achievement in astronomy.

Health authorities review the country's preparedness for the new Influenza A(H3N2) variant.

Pediatricians warn of a resurgence of preventable diseases due to declining childhood vaccination rates.

Colo Colo secures a European player as their second reinforcement for the upcoming season.

A study identifies the anti-inflammatory effects of the golden berry on intestinal inflammation.

The MINSAL updates summer preventive measures, focusing on forest fires and influenza vigilance.
